Since ancient times,the act of good intention has played an important role in promoting mutual trust and harmonious atmosphere of society in our country.Its behavior does not have legal meaning and is attributed to moral regulation.In recent years,with the development of our society,the cases of damage caused by good intention often occur.However,due to the lack of legislation in our country,the parties in good intention will not consider the consequences of bearing the responsibility.In practice,they have applied other legal provisions or quoted the basic principles to deal with by analogy,resulting in the inability to define the responsibility of both parties,and caused new problems,that is,how to evaluate well Act of freewill? How to identify and divide the liability for the damage caused by this special act? Through four levels,this paper distinguishes the difference between the act of good will giving and other acts,then summarizes the elements of the damage caused by the act of good will giving according to the case,analyzes the principle of liability fixation,distribution and relief,and finally,based on the actual situation of our country,puts forward specific suggestions,in order to deal with the disputes caused by ordinary social behaviors,draw the boundaries between law and morality,clarify the responsibility sharing and maintenance We should protect the interests of both sides and do our part to promote the improvement of China's legal system.
